For Sale: 1973 Datsun 240Z in san jose, California

Vehicle Description

This 1973 Datsun 240Z is a stunning example of a fully restored classic, with every detail handled by the expert team at Santa Clara Performance 20 years ago. This rust-free California car represents a rare opportunity to own a meticulously rebuilt, numbers-matching vehicle that is as tight today as it was following its frame-off restoration.

Engine and transmission

  • Original L24 engine: The heart of this 240Z is its original, numbers-matching 2.4-liter inline-six L24 engine. It produces the iconic 150 horsepower and was completely rebuilt to factory specifications.
  • Smooth-shifting manual: A rebuilt 4-speed manual transmission delivers a connected and exhilarating driving experience that is as tight as the day the restoration was completed.
